Part 1: Preparing Your Hair – The Foundation of a Great Style
Before you even pick up your straightener or curling iron, proper hair preparation is crucial. Neglecting this step can lead to damaged hair, uneven styling, and ultimately, disappointing results. Here's what you need to do:
Cleanse and Condition: Start with freshly washed and conditioned hair. Use a shampoo and conditioner suited to your hair type (fine, thick, curly, etc.). Avoid using heavy products that can weigh your hair down, especially if you're aiming for volume.
Towel Dry Gently: Roughly drying your hair with a towel can lead to breakage. Instead, gently pat your hair dry with a microfiber towel or an old t-shirt. This minimizes friction and helps preserve the hair cuticle.
Apply Heat Protectant: This is arguably the most important step. Heat protectant sprays or serums create a barrier between your hair and high heat, preventing damage and dryness. Apply it evenly throughout your hair before using any heat styling tools.
Detangle Carefully: Use a wide-tooth comb or a detangling brush to gently remove any knots or tangles. Start from the ends and work your way up to the roots to minimize breakage. Never brush wet hair aggressively.
Part 2: Mastering the Art of Straightening
Achieving perfectly straight hair requires the right tools and technique.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Choose the Right Straightener: Invest in a good quality flat iron with adjustable temperature settings. Ceramic or tourmaline plates are generally preferred for their even heat distribution and less damage.
Section Your Hair: Divide your hair into manageable sections. The smaller the sections, the straighter and smoother your hair will be. Use clips to keep the sections separated.
Straightening Technique: Clamp a small section of hair between the plates, close to the roots. Slowly and smoothly glide the straightener down the length of the hair, avoiding jerky movements. Repeat until all sections are straightened.
Finishing Touches: Once your hair is straight, you can add a shine serum or hairspray to maintain the style and add extra gloss.
Part 3: Creating Stunning Curls
Curling your hair offers endless possibilities, from loose waves to tight ringlets. The key is choosing the right curling iron and mastering the technique:
Select Your Curling Iron: Curling irons come in various sizes and barrel types. Smaller barrels create tighter curls, while larger barrels produce looser waves. Consider your desired curl size when making your selection.
Sectioning is Key: As with straightening, sectioning your hair is vital for even curls. Use clips to keep the sections separated.
Curling Techniques: There are several techniques, including wrapping the hair around the barrel, using a clamp-style iron, or using a wand. Experiment to find the method that works best for you and your hair type. Avoid keeping the iron in one place for too long, as this can damage your hair.
Setting Your Curls: Once you've curled all the sections, allow the curls to cool slightly before gently running your fingers through them to loosen them up. You can use a light-hold hairspray to maintain the curls.
Part 4: Maintaining Your Style and Protecting Your Hair
Once you've achieved your desired look, maintaining it and protecting your hair is crucial. Here are some tips:
Use the Right Products: Use hair products specifically designed to maintain your style. Hairspray, mousses, and serums can help prolong the life of your straight or curly hair.
Protect Your Hair at Night: To prevent frizz and tangles, sleep on a silk or satin pillowcase. You can also braid your hair before bed to maintain your style.
Deep Condition Regularly: Heat styling can dry out your hair, so regular deep conditioning treatments are essential to keep it healthy and hydrated.
Avoid Over-Styling: Give your hair a break from heat styling occasionally to allow it to recover. Embrace your natural texture sometimes!
